我国工业企业科技经费支出结构的信息熵变化研究

摘    要:使用信息熵方法对我国1995--2011年的工业企业科技经费支出情况进行了时间序列分析,得出以下结论:过去的近20年中我国工业企业科技经费支出信息熵和均衡度呈现波动下降状态,偏离度则呈逐渐上升趋势,体现了我国工业企业科技经费支出结构由低集中度向高集中度转移。相关性分析结论为:科技产出中的绝大部分指标、三次产业发展均与信息熵为负相关关系,即科技成果增多、产业发展会使工业企业科技经费支出结构集中度得到提高。

Research on Information Entropy Changes in Structure of Science and Technology Funds Industrial Enterprise Expenditure in China

Abstract:In this paper, we conduct time sequence analysis to science and technology funds expenditures of industrial enterprises in China from year 1995 to 2011 based on information entropy method. The following conclusion: the information entropy and equilibri- um degree of our country science and technology funds expenditures of industrial enterprises in nearly 20 years in the past fluctuated downward, deviation degree is a gradually rising trend, which reflects the structure of science and technology funds expenditures of en- terprises in our country transfers from low concentration to the high concentration. Correlation analysis conclusion is: the most indica- tors, three industrial development in the scientific and technological output have negative relationship with information entropy, increase in scientific and technological achievements and industrial development will improve the concentration of expenditure structure of indus- try enterprises.
